Photo of Monty Basgall


Monty Basgall

Romanus Basgall

Position: Second Baseman
Bats: Right, Throws: Right
Height: 5' 10", Weight: 175 lb.

Born: February 8, 1922 in Pfeifer, KS
High School: Pfeifer HS (Pfeifer, KS)
School: Sterling University (Sterling, KS)
Signed
by the Brooklyn Dodgers as an amateur free agent in 1942. (All Transactions)
Debut: April 19, 1948
Team: Pirates 1948-1951

Final Game: August 11, 1951
Died: September 22, 2005 in Sierra Vista, AZ
Buried: Mother Teresa Columbarium, Sierra Vista, AZ
